Currently in the process of doing this. My visa expired two years ago, I left 3 years ago.
Just bring your old F4 card, passport and all the documents you used when originally getting the visa. They will take your old card, take your photocopied docs and will ask for a passport like photo from you. Will update when I have the actual card in my hands sometime in February 2012. |

Took about 3 weeks for my card to be in my hands. If you've been out of the country when your F-4 expired then there is no penalty. Just pay 60,000-won. Bring a photo, all the docs you used to apply originally, passport and your old card. |
